S7E8 Chip Esten

Feb 07, 2005 Season 7 Episode 8 Comedy, Reality

Chip takes the stage on Let's Make a Date, eager to pick between three unique contestants: a fierce female wrestler seeking her secret Valentine admirer, Wayne, the crazed Headless Horseman in search of a new head, Colin, and Ryan, a playful gargoyle from Notre Dame who keeps coming to life to stir up chaos. In a hilarious "Film, TV, and Theater Styles" skit, Colin plays a heartbroken bride, while Wayne is her furious mother, consulting designer Ryan about a wedding dress disaster, blending styles like MacGyver and soap opera. They follow this with a Doo-Wop tribute to Erica, who met her end in a bizarre gene-splicing incident, and a “Songs of the Lunchlady” segment featuring both hillbilly and punk hits. Ultimately, Colin emerges victorious, leading to a Props showdown between Chip and Wayne against Ryan and Drew.
